While players have already started playing the game, one thing that can be a bit annoying is the large download size for the game.
For PC gamers, it is almost 30+ GB, making it take up a large space in your computer. However, there is a fix to that and this article will focus on how to reduce the file size on PC.
Modern Warfare 2 on PC is playable on two different platforms. Players can either use Steam to launch the game or Battle Net. For both, the download size is a bit different. For Steam users, the pre-load size is 29.9 GB. After the installation, it will be 30.5 GB.
However, Battle Net takes a bit more space to install the game. Players need to download 34.6 GB of files to play the game.
